Wheel disc breakage caused Mysore train mishap
Thursday, October 23 2003 11:54 Hrs (IST)

Bangalore: Railway authorities on October 23 said, breakage of wheel disc of one of the coaches has been found to be the prima facie cause of the Mysore-Bangalore passenger train accident that left five persons dead and 53 injured between Naganahalli and Pandavapur stations in Mandya district.

A detailed inquiry into the accident would be held by the Commissioner of Railway Safety, Southern Circle, Bangalore, a railway press release said.

Four rearmost coaches have been capsized and derailed, while relief and rescue operations were on in full swing, the statement said.

Railway officials said a relief train has been rushed to the accident spot from Mysore to ferry back the stranded passengers.

The railways announced cancellation of seven trains between Bangalore and Mysore and partially cancelled eight others.

The statement gave the names of four persons who died in the mishap as Syeed Tahseena, Asheena, Prabhamani and Suma.

Union Minister of State for Railways Basanagoud Patil Yatnal announced a compensation of Rs one lakh to those killed, Rs 25,000 to the seriously injured and Rs 5,000 for passengers who received minor injuries.
